The critical function of a Level 2 ASP Electrician in Hornsby is vital for making sure the electrical power network in this major New South Wales hub runs efficiently, safely, and in accordance with policies. Holding the well-regarded title of Accredited Service Provider, these specialists have gone through rigid certification procedures from both state authorities and regional Distribution Network Company, such as Ausgrid or Endeavour Energy. What sets them apart is that a basic electrical licence does not grant permission to work on the high-voltage infrastructure connecting properties to the primary grid, whereas a Level 2 ASP Electrician is legally empowered to do so. Through extensive training and unwavering commitment to safety and technical standards, they have actually earned the exclusive right to work with high-voltage power supplies, browsing the intricacies and risks associated with this domain.
A Level 2 ASP Electrician in Hornsby focuses on the 'service connection' element of electrical systems, concentrating on the infrastructure from the street pole or underground pit to the home's meter box. When building new buildings or making significant additions, homeowner and designers often require the proficiency of these professionals to establish a new power supply. The installation of customer mains, which are the primary cables that provide electricity, is an important job that can just be performed by a certified Level 2 ASP Electrician in Hornsby. This complex process involves precise preparation to identify the suitable present capacity and the most safe cable route, whether overhead to the Point of Attachment or underground through thoroughly excavated trenches and channel installations. Ultimately, the Level 2 ASP Electrician in Hornsby is click here accountable for guaranteeing that all new connections adhere to local regulations and standards, licensing that the setup is safe and ready for energization.

As homes in Hornsby incorporate advanced technologies like high-capacity lorry charging stations, their outdated single-phase power systems often end up being insufficient. To resolve this, a complex treatment including three-phase connection is needed, requiring the specialized knowledge of a Level 2 ASP Electrician Hornsby. This intricate process involves carefully isolating the existing power connection, modifying the customer mains to handle increased need, potentially upgrading the primary electrical panel and safety devices, and then re-establishing the power connection with approval from the distribution network provider. By undertaking this important upgrade, property owners can ensure their home's electrical securely support growing energy requirements over the long term.
Possibly the most vital and time-sensitive service provided by a Level 2 ASP Electrician Hornsby is the rectification of electrical problem notices. These official warnings are provided by the network supplier when an evaluation identifies a fault in the client's service apparatus-- such as a harmed or decaying private power pole, malfunctioning service fuses, or non-compliant cable television connection points-- that positions a significant security danger. Property owners are legally mandated to have these problems repaired by a certified Level 2 ASP within a specified, typically short, timeframe to prevent the property's power supply from being detached. The quick, authorised intervention of a Level 2 ASP Electrician Hornsby is invaluable in these urgent circumstances. They possess the exclusive authority to isolate the power supply, perform the required high-risk repairs-- which may involve operating at height with specialised devices or performing civil works for underground faults-- and after that provide the required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work (CCEW) to the network operator, ensuring the rapid and safe restoration or continuation of power.
In Hornsby, the special authority for all electrical power metering jobs rests with the recognized Level 2 ASP Electrician. This expert is distinctively qualified to handle the setup, replacement, moving, and updating of various electricity meters, including the required shift to advanced smart meters that facilitate exact billing and smooth solar energy combination. When a considerable home restoration needs meter box relocation, just a licensed Level 2 ASP Electrician is legally allowed to undertake the task. Similarly, for properties that count on private power poles, this expert is the go-to professional for pole replacement and repair work, ensuring the stability and safety of overhead lines.
